The Department of Transportation and Public Facilities (DOT&PF) Bridge Design Section is looking for an Engineer/Architect 1 to help us Keep Alaska Moving!
What you will be doing:
In this position you will perform structural engineering analysis and calculations for the development of bridge load ratings bridge management tasks and overload permit assessment. You will also complete bridge safety inspections including routine non-redundant steel tension member (NSTM) low water and in-depth inspections. Some design and preparation of bridge construction plans specifications cost estimates and report tasks may be involved as well.
Our organization mission and culture:
The DOT&PF Bridge Section provides design services for new bridge and bridge rehabilitation construction projects as well as a broad range of services associated with the existing inventory of the States 1000 public highway bridges. We work hard to support our Departments mission toKeep Alaska Moving.
The Bridge Section is a production-oriented office comprised of hands-on engineers who put safety first and are recognized nationally as experts in our field. The office culture is supportive and encouraging with opportunities for growth. The office has 25 staff members small enough to be personal but large enough to have a broad knowledge base in all subdisciplines of bridge engineering. The position offers the satisfaction of knowing youve made significant accomplishments to build and preserve Alaskas infrastructure.

Minimum Qualifications
Registration as a Professional Engineer (PE) or Architect.
Note: Positions in this class require professional registration as either an Engineer or an Architect. The employer will designate which professional field is required for each position.
Special Note:
Persons not registered in the State of Alaska must be registered in a state recognized by the State Board of Registration for Architects Engineers and Land Surveyors eligible for comity in accordance with AS 08.48.191(b). Persons employed under this provision must become registered in Alaska within one year of hire and sign an agreement to this effect as a condition of employment.
